Additional Information
Since I've worked a couple months now, I should finally update. The club does get crowded after all, but only after 10 pm. We get a lot of men in suits, millionairs, young marines, and female customers. The young rich guys will run a tab of thousands, but the Czech girls have the monopoly on the better clientel. It's not that hard to get a dance. They are always running two for ones.
There are a few new policies:
You have to schedule yourself for three days minimum.
If you miss a scheduled day you have to pay your stage fee plus a $20 fine.
If there are at least four girls there is only one break song.
Five or more girls and there is no break song.
More than ten girls and they run the second stage so you're up there for the next girls songs whether you like it or not.
I can't think of anything else. Management is great. There is a house mom. %10 goes to the DJ, at least $5 to each of the two doormen and stage fees work like this:
Club opens at 11:30. If you get there before it opens no stage fee. 11:30 - 2 the fee is $20, before 6 it's $30, before 9 it's $40, 9 - 10pm it's $50. You can not come in any later. And there is a mandatory day shift every week, unless you want to just pay a $15 fine.
Best thing about this club is the girls aren't catty.
